Slip back in time 100 years to the Roaring ‘20s and the Golden Age of Hollywood — full of glamour and glitter at Museum by Moonlight, The Children’s Museum biggest single-night fundraiser. The themed event takes place during a time in which guys wore pinstripe suits with sporty hats, such as a fedora or round bowler. “Dolls,” as they were called back then, donned loose-fitting flapper dresses that made it easier to swing to up-tempo jazz. The beads and fringe created quite the visual.
On August 26, guests ages 21 and older will enjoy an elegant evening from 7 p.m. until the infamous water clock strikes midnight. With two levels of tickets available, all guests receive access to exclusive spaces and activities, as well as a tax acknowledgement letter. A VIP ticket provides early access to the festivities, including a silent auction, premium tastings, delicious food catered by some of the city’s best restaurants and much more.
